New "Lunchtime LIVE" webinar series on substance abuse and child welfare practice coming in March
Lunchtime LIVE (Learning Interactions with Valued Experts) is a free monthly webinar series designed to improve understanding of substance use disorders and their impact on child welfare practice. The series provides access to content experts and an opportunity to explore practice applications across systems. After the webinar, participants receive a summary of the session with links and resources to encourage additional learning. The goal is to improve the use of evidence-based practices in child welfare, the courts, and treatment systems that will assist families impacted by substance abuse. Join Lunchtime LIVE from noon to 1 p.m. on Fridays at the end of each month starting in March. Scheduled topics include “Understanding Addiction: Implications for Practice” (March 31), “Medication Assisted Treatment—Supporting Parents & Assuring Child Safety” (April 28), “Relating Current Ohio Opiate Epidemic Trends to Child Welfare Practice” (May 26), and “Best Practice Spotlight—Engaging Families in the Treatment Process” (June 23). The training is made possible by the Ohio Child Welfare Training Program’s Substance Abuse Training Partnership, and caseworkers/supervisors can count the time as supplemental training. Call for Presentations: OACCA Conference
OACCA is seeking volunteers to lead workshops at the 20th Annual OACCA Conference on April 26-27, 2017.  The proposal deadline is February 27. Desired topic areas include provider readiness for Medicaid Managed Care; readiness for the Ohio Behavioral Health Medicaid Re-Design; child health quality initiatives; best practices in serving youth aging out of foster care; strategies to recruit and retain foster caregivers and adoptive families; innovations and best practices in behavioral health or foster care; public policy: child welfare, behavioral health, juvenile justice. 2017 Kids Summit
Voices will be offering the statewide Kids Summit, which will combine elements of their annual Advocacy Day and Kids Health Conference into one comprehensive, 3-day event. The 2017 Summit will offer 7 tracks featuring experts, presentations, and resources tailored to Safe, Healthy, Educated, Connected, and Employable PLUS bonus tracks on Early Care and Education and Juvenile Justice. Attendees will have the option of registering for a specific track or sampling a variety of workshops based on their interests. Voices has also incorporated Advocacy Day into Day 2 of the event. Legislators will join attendees for a special education policy-focused luncheon and participate in legislative visits with constituents in the afternoon. Overall, the event promises to serve as an important touch point for child advocates, service providers, educators, parents, youth, and policymakers and a key forum on child policy in the state of Ohio. The summit will be held March 29-31 at Sheraton Hotel on Capital Square, Columbus. Learn more
